Custom Welding for Gate Frames and Structural Repair
Woodland Hills’s hillside properties put extraordinary loads on gate hardware. Santa Ana winds funnel through the western Valley and hit exposed swing gates with sudden lateral force that fatigues mild-steel brackets in three to five years. We fabricate and weld heavy-duty hinge plates, reinforced jamb posts, and gusseted frame corners on-site — no waiting for an outside metal shop, no “we’ll come back when the part arrives.” Our mobile welding rig handles steel, aluminum, and ornamental iron up to 1/2-inch plate.

Hinge Replacement for Heavy and Custom Gates
Standard hinges from the hardware store are rated for residential pedestrian gates, not the 600-pound automated driveway gates common in Woodland Hills’s 1970s–1990s custom-home stock. We source and install ball-bearing, greaseable, and adjustable hinges with load ratings matched to your gate’s actual weight and wind exposure. For hillside properties above Mulholland Drive, we regularly upgrade to four-hinge systems or custom-welded continuous piano-hinge arrangements that distribute Santa Ana wind loads across the full jamb.

Rail Repair and Track Realignment
Aluminum slide-gate tracks expand dramatically in Woodland Hills’s direct summer sun. A track that measured true in March can grow 1/4-inch by August, binding rollers and overloading the operator. We grind expanded sections, re-shim mounting points, and in severe cases replace with steel track or install thermal-expansion gaps. This is seasonal, predictable work in Woodland Hills — we do more track service calls July through September than any other three-month period.

Post Replacement and Concrete Work
Gate posts in Woodland Hills fail from two directions: soil movement on hillside lots, and rot or rust at the concrete interface on older flatland installations. We extract failed posts, pour new footings to spec, and often weld custom post caps or adapter plates that let us reuse existing gate hardware. For 91364 and 91367 properties in fire zones, we verify that post-mounted operators and access hardware maintain required clearances from combustible structures — another inspection point generalists miss.

Common Gate Parts & Welding Problems We See in Woodland Hills Homes
- Motor thermal shutdown in summer heat waves. Early-model Viking and DoorKing operators in Woodland Hills regularly overheat and fail to open when ambient temperatures exceed 105°F. We replace with heat-tolerant units or add external cooling fans and thermal bypasses.
- Track expansion jamming rollers. Aluminum tracks grow in direct sun, binding gate rollers against the guide. We grind, re-shim, and in chronic cases convert to steel track with expansion joints — a seasonal specialty in this heat pocket.
- Wiring insulation cracking from UV and heat exposure. Standard PVC wire on hillside gate mounts degrades to bare copper in 3–4 years here. We replace with high-temp THHN in liquid-tight conduit, rated for 150°F ambient.
- Hinge fatigue after Santa Ana wind events. Exposed hillside swing gates take lateral loads that standard hinges aren’t designed for. We weld reinforced brackets and upgrade to continuous or multi-point hinge systems.
